Revenir To Play The United Kingdom

I have loved this band for a while but as they are based in New Jersey, it is impossible to see them. They are just starting out but making a big noise in NJ/NY. Please would you pass this on so that we can get as many people to sign, so that they may play over in the UK. They have fans over here who love them to bits and would to see them play. Make our wish come true

